4. Warranty

(1) Warranty period

The warranty period for IDEC products shall be one (1) year after purchase or 

delivery to the specified location. However, this shall not apply in cases where 

there is a different specification in the Catalogs or there is another agreement 

in place between you and IDEC.

(2) Warranty scope

Should a failure occur in an IDEC product during the above warranty period 

for reasons attributable to IDEC, then IDEC shall replace or repair that 

product, free of charge, at the purchase location / delivery location of the 

product, or an IDEC service base. However, failures caused by the following 

reasons shall be deemed outside the scope of this warranty.
i.  The product was handled or used deviating from the conditions /  

 

environment listed in the Catalogs
ii.  The failure was caused by reasons other than an IDEC product
iii.  Modification or repair was performed by a party other than IDEC
iv.  The failure was caused by a software program of a party other than  

 

IDEC
v.  The product was used outside of its original purpose
vi.   Replacement of maintenance parts, installation of accessories, or the like 

was not performed properly in accordance with the user’s manual and 

Catalogs

vii.  The failure could not have been predicted with the scientific and  

 

technical standards at the time when the product was shipped from  

 

IDEC
viii.   The failure was due to other causes not attributable to IDEC (including 

cases of force majeure such as natural disasters and other disasters)

Furthermore, the warranty described here refers to a warranty on the IDEC 

product as a unit, and damages induced by the failure of an IDEC product are 

excluded from this warranty.
